# Christiaan Barnard

> South African cardiac surgeon

## Summary
Christiaan Barnard was a South African cardiac surgeon best known for performing the world's first successful human heart transplant in 1967. A pioneer in cardiovascular surgery, he revolutionized organ transplantation and advanced medical science through his groundbreaking work.

### Early Life and Education
Christiaan Barnard was born on November 8, 1922, in Beaufort West, South Africa. He pursued his medical education at the University of Cape Town, where he earned his Bachelor of Medicine and Bachelor of Surgery (MBChB) in 1946. He furthered his studies at the University of Minnesota, obtaining his Doctor of Medicine (MD) in 1950. His academic background laid the foundation for his career in cardiovascular surgery.

### Career and Professional Affiliations
Barnard began his career at Groote Schuur Hospital in Cape Town, where he specialized in cardiovascular surgery. He remained affiliated with the hospital for over five decades, conducting groundbreaking research and performing life-saving surgeries. His work at Groote Schuur Hospital established him as a leading figure in the field of heart transplantation.

### Groundbreaking Heart Transplant
In 1967, Barnard performed the world's first successful human heart transplant on Louis Washkansky, a patient with terminal heart disease. This historic procedure demonstrated the feasibility of organ transplantation and revolutionized medical science. Washkansky survived for 18 days, providing critical data for future transplant surgeries.
